Wakehurst is located 25 minutes south of the M25 and 30 minutes north of Brighton, nestled in the High Weald. Located on the B2028, south of Turners Hill and north of Ardingly. From London, take the M25 and M23, leave at Junction 10, turn left onto the A264.
